The IT Project Manager is responsible for planning, executing, tracking, and delivering a wide range of IT-related projects, including new branch builds, core and digital banking software implementations, AI initiatives, and infrastructure upgrades. This position is a hands-on role that will require managing project tasks, coordinating stakeholders, and performing project implementation activities. The IT Project Manager operates within the regulatory framework established by the Federal Financial Institutions Examination Council (FFIEC), Federal Deposit Insurance Corporation (FDIC), Federal Reserve, and Office of the Comptroller of the Currency (OCC). This role is responsible for ensuring that technology initiatives include appropriate project management tasks, documentation, controls, and status reporting aligned with supervisory expectations for governance, risk management, and operational resilience.
